Still more time before the city gets the keys to the new recreation centre

    Corner Brook Mayor Jim Parsons says it could still be another couple of weeks before the keys to the new recreation centre are handed over. The $ 25 million dollar facility includes multiple pools, a fitness area and a daycare, which will be operated by the YMCA. It was announced in 2020 and was scheduled to be open in the summer of 2023. That was pushed ahead to last September due to issues with the pool. Parsons says the pools are ready but there are still a few things to take care of. He says the new centre will be a huge asset for the city and its residents.
